ABOUT NATOORA
Natoora started 20 years ago with a very simple, yet powerful goal to find incredible flavour in fresh produce. Today, our dedication to this mission has grown into an impactful network of over 500 independent growers spanning nine sourcing hubs across three continents.
We work with hundreds of kitchens and some of the most exciting and influential chefs in London, New York, Miami, Copenhagen, Paris, and Melbourne. However, our commitment to creating a better food system also extends beyond professional kitchens to a strong community of home consumers across the US and the UK.
On the way, we have been named a Sunday Times Fast Track 100 Company, appeared on the Financial Times’ list of Europe’s fastest-growing companies, and proudly received a GQ Food & Drinks Sustainability Award.
About the role
Natoora has spent two decades reshaping how chefs and home cooks think about fresh produce — championing seasonality, varietal diversity, and building direct relationships with a vast network of growers. Our retail channel is where that mission crosses over to consumers from our core restaurant market, and it is the single biggest growth opportunity for the business.
We are looking for a National Account Controller to own and develop that opportunity. You will lead the team that manages our existing relationships — Ocado and Waitrose, alongside Whole Foods, Zapp and some smaller accounts — and you will be personally responsible for two strategic goals: firstly, significantly expanding our business with Waitrose and secondly, positioning for and then taking the brand into the wider UK retail sector via the major multiples.
This is a Senior National Account Controller role: you will own the retail P&L, leverage existing or develop new relationships within retailers, and develop and deliver the internal roadmap that will make Natoora a success.
Responsibilities
Retail strategy: Build and own the multi-year budget for Natoora within UK grocery — with a focus on new growth opportunities and how to deliver them. Lead the internal roadmap on the product and marketing investment required to support that growth.
Grow Waitrose and expand within UK multiples.
Build the case for store-count expansion and range optimisation and develop and execute the entry strategy for further grocery retailers within the first 24 months. This includes shaping the proposition, leading outreach, tendering and onboarding processes, and ensuring we are set up to deliver from day one.
Run the existing client portfolio.
Oversee the team of National Account Managers, ensure Ocado, Whole Foods, Zapp and other accounts continue to grow and we develop our offer in tandem with their teams. Continue to grow profitably, meeting service levels, and manage them with a real understanding of how these accounts can be improved. You will guide the Joint Business Plans and hold key client relationships that can be leveraged as needed.
Own the P&L.
You will be responsible for sales volumes, net revenue, gross margin, marketing investment, and customer profitability across the retail channel. You will build the annual budget, then review report and forecast monthly performance.
Lead the team.
Assess then mentor and develop the retail account management team. You will set the standards for range planning and delivery of strategy, internal collaboration and client management.
Be the internal lead for retail.
Work closely with sourcing, supply chain, marketing and finance to make sure all relevant departments are aligned and set to successfully deliver the retail goals.
What we’re looking for
Experience of UK grocery —a National Account Manager or Controller inside an FMCG business who can hit the ground running to deliver a plan and results, with a proven track record of managing a team plus a successful launch within a major retailer. Fresh category experience is a benefit.
Confidence interpreting financial and sales data to inform decisions and experience in trend analysis and market research to identify emerging opportunities.
Strong organisational and project management skills, with the ability to manage multiple accounts and priorities simultaneously. A keen problem solver who remains calm under pressure.
What success looks like
First 6 months: a credible strategy for grocery expansion; Waitrose store count and turnover increased in line with already established targets; a major multiple entry plan agreed and being executed; the existing client base growing profitably; a retail team that has developed significantly under your leadership.
6 to 24 months: Natoora is a meaningful fresh produce supplier to at least one of the larger UK multiples, Waitrose has become a genuine strategic partnership rather than a single-account relationship, and the retail channel is a recognised engine of growth for the business.
